Tupen 5 1235010002
-
Upload
abrianto-nugraha -
Category
Education
-
view
68 -
download
2
description
Transcript of Tupen 5 1235010002
TUGAS PENDAHULUAN
PRAKTIKUM SQL
MODUL 5
Nama Praktikan :
Abrianto Nugraha (1235010002)
A-3
Nama Instruktur :
Ikhwan Rustanto , S.Kom
Asisten :
Rizka Annisa (1135010045)
LABORATORIUM BASIS DATA
SISTEM INFORMASI – FTI
UNIVERSITAS PEMBANGUNAN NASIONAL “VETERAN” JATIM
2014
LEMBAR PENGESAHAN
Nama : Abrianto Nugraha
NPM : 1235010002
Sesi : A3
Judul : Penggunaan SubQueries(Modul 5)
Surabaya, 26 Mei 2014
Asisten Praktikum
(Rizka Annisa)
BAB I
DASAR TEORI
Subquery merupakan salah satu statement SELECT yang melekat pada klausa statement SELECT yang lain. Subquery (Inner query) dieksekusi sebelum Main Query (Outer Query). Hasil dari subquery digunakan oleh query utama. Subqueries dapat ditempatkan di sejumlah klausa SQL, seperti biasa klausa WHERE, klausa HAVING, dan klausa FROM
Syntax SubQuery
SELECT select_list
FROM table_name
WHERE expression Operator
( SELECT select_list
FROM table_name)
PEDOMAN PENGGUNAAN SUBQUERY
1. Subquery dituliskan dalam tanda kurung
2. Subquery ditempatkan pada sisi kanan dari perbandingan kondisi
3. Outer dan inner query dapat mengambil data dari tabel yang berbeda
4. Subquery tidak dapat memiliki klausa ORDER BY sendiri. Klausa ORDER BY ditempatkan diakhir outer query
Statement SELECT di dalam kurung adalah inner query atau subquery.
Statement SELECT di dalam kurung adalah inner query atau subquery.
BAB II
PERMASALAHAN
1. Pelajari pengunaan JOIN & relasinya
2. Jelaskan fungsi & manfaat USING SUBQUERIES TO SOLVE QUERIS & beri contoh penerapannya di lingkungan
3. HR department ingin menampilkan report dari pegawainya yang lebih besar dari gaji ADAM, report yang ada berisi kolom sbb :
- First_name & last_name yang digabung menjadi “Complete Name”
- Department_name
- Job_id
- State_province
4. Tampilkan last_name, job_id, job_title, gaji, & city yang memiliki job_id sama dengan De Haan
BAB III
PENYELESAIAN
1. Pelajari pengunaan JOIN & relasinya
2. Jelaskan fungsi & manfaat USING SUBQUERIES TO SOLVE QUERIS & beri contoh penerapannya di lingkungan
3. HR department ingin menampilkan report dari pegawainya yang lebih besar dari gaji ADAM, report yang ada berisi kolom sbb :
- First_name & last_name yang digabung menjadi “Complete Name”
- Department_name
- Job_id
- State_province
4. Tampilkan last_name, job_id, job_title, gaji, & city yang memiliki job_id sama dengan De Haan
BAB IV
KESIMPULAN
Subquery merupakan salah satu statement SELECT yang melekat pada klausa statement SELECT yang lain. Subquery (Inner query) dieksekusi sebelum Main Query (Outer Query). Hasil dari subquery digunakan oleh query utama. Subqueries dapat ditempatkan di sejumlah klausa SQL, seperti biasa klausa WHERE, klausa HAVING, dan klausa FROM
PEDOMAN PENGGUNAAN SUBQUERY
1. Subquery dituliskan dalam tanda kurung
2. Subquery ditempatkan pada sisi kanan dari perbandingan kondisi
3. Outer dan inner query dapat mengambil data dari tabel yang berbeda
4. Subquery tidak dapat memiliki klausa ORDER BY sendiri. Klausa ORDER BY ditempatkan diakhir outer query
BAB V
DAFTAR PUSTAKA
Modul Praktikum Structured Query Language